About this podcast

Why do some retailers and banks thrive while others struggle to keep up? At Undercover Customer , we tackle the industry's biggest problem today: understanding the real customer experience. We reveal the hidden factors that impact customer satisfaction, loyalty, and growth through in-depth mystery shopping insights and expert analysis. Join us as we explore the untold stories behind the data, uncovering what truly drives success in retail and banking. Whether you’re a retail leader looking to stay ahead or a curious listener eager to learn more, this podcast offers a fresh perspective on the strategies that make or break a business. Tune in for episodes filled with surprising discoveries, practical takeaways, and the intelligence you need to outperform the competition. Undercover Customer - Your go-to podcast for uncovering the hidden truths in retail and banking through the lens of mystery shopping.
